The heavy duty hose made with real steel!

HydroSteel's unique 3-layer hose is designed to brave even the toughest conditions. Its rust-resistant rubber interior is encased in leak-proof 304 stainless steel and a polyester exterior, making it perfect for outdoor tasks while providing a steady high-pressure water flow. With its interlocking steel and flexible design, you can take it anywhere!

  • Stretch it, drag it, and pull it around without worrying about snags, kinks, or splits
  • The unique 3-layer design creates the ideal hose: smooth water flow thanks to the RUBBER inner tube, reliable protection from kinks, punctures, and leaks with the STEEL middle layer, and durable WEAVE that can withstand the elements for years.
  • Solid brass fittings are crush resistant and engineered to withstand extreme force while the on/off valve makes the output easy to control
  • 500PSI burst strength guarantees trusted performance and long life
  • Kink free
  • Does not expand or retract guaranteeing a steady and uninterrupted flow of water
  • Built to withstand extreme conditions - from sub-zero temperatures, the hose can be frozen in a block of ice to being left in the sun for days
